Dealing with Common Plesk Installation Errors

During the installation process of Plesk, you might face a variety of errors. These glitches can range from minor inconveniences to more serious problems that halt the full installation. Fortunately, many common Plesk installation errors have straightforward solutions that can be implemented. Here are some common Plesk installation problems and their possible solutions:

* **Database Connection Failure:** This error arises when Plesk fails to the database server. To address this, ensure that the database server is running, and verify the database credentials in the Plesk installation settings are correct.

* **File Permissions Error:** Plesk requires specific file permissions to work correctly. If the wrong file permissions are set, it can result installation failures. Use a command-line tool like `chmod` to set the file permissions according to Plesk's recommendations.

* **Apache Configuration Errors:** If Apache, the web server used by Plesk, is not initialized correctly, it can stop the installation. Carefully examine the Apache configuration files and make any necessary modifications.

* **System Requirements Not Met:** Plesk has specific system requirements that must be satisfied for a proper installation. Ensure your system meets these requirements, which may include CPU speed, RAM size, and operating system version.

* **Network Connectivity Problems:** A stable internet connection is essential for Plesk installation. If you are encountering network connectivity issues, troubleshoot them before proceeding with the installation.
